F1 2014 Season Review: Williams, Valtteri Bottas and Felipe Massa

WILLIAMS – THE ICONIC TEAM RETURNS TO THE FRONT Williams Martini Racing was one of the surprise packages of the 2014 F1 season, with considerable changes transforming the team into a front-running outfit. It was a complete contrast to 2013, a torrid year that saw the eight-time constructors’ champions score just five points. Felipe Massa joined Williams from Ferrari as its lead driver, partnering Valtteri Bottas, who quietly impressed despite below-par machinery in his rookie campaign in 2013.
